Analysis

In 2015, fatal occupational injuries among employees in Kyrgyzstan stood at 4.1. That is the lowest value across all 11 years on record.

That represents a change of down 31.7% on the previous year and down 18.0% over ten years.

Over the whole period, fatal occupational injuries among employees in Kyrgyzstan peaked at 8 in 2004 and was at its lowest, 4.1, in 2015.

That places Kyrgyzstan 24th out of 79 countries with data for 2015,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 11 years of available data.
